  • Asthma drug mepolizumab tested in polish patients – results show promise

    Disease control Completed

    This study followed 106 adults with severe eosinophilic asthma in Poland who received mepolizumab injections every 4 weeks for at least a year. Researchers tracked how many asthma attacks patients had and whether they needed oral steroids. The goal was to see if the drug helps co…
